a Both statewide agencies/programs and individual Medicaid plans submitted CAHPS survey data to the National CAHPS Benchmarking Database in 2006 and 2007. A portion of these plans submitted data in both years; however, some plans submitted data in only 2006 or 2007. Despite the variability in terms of participating plans/programs and state agencies, and given that the same CAHPS survey instrument and survey administration protocols were followed in both years, the composite scores are comparable over this 2-year period.
